
The 24th International and Interdisciplinary Conference of Communication, Medicine and Ethics
(COMET )
5-7 August 2026
The Pre-COMET Masterclass is scheduled for 4 August 2026
The COMET conference aims to bring together scholars from different disciplinary backgrounds involving various healthcare specialties and the human and social sciences. A special emphasis is on the dissemination of ongoing research in language/discourse/communication studies in relation to healthcare education, patient participation and professional ethics.
The 2026 conference is hosted by Yokohama City University in association with Yokohama City University Medical Centre, Japan.
